Fundamental attribution error is when ____

Answer

Fundamental attribution error is when individuals attribute character too strongly to explain someones actions
ex: Bill cuts off Jill in traffic. Jill says "it must be because hes a piece of shit human who only cares about himself and has no regard for other people". In reality, Bill is super nice and is just running late for his flight.
